Pierre-Alexis Dumas, Artistic Director of Hermès and sixth-generation family member, shares insights into the brand's legacy and unparalleled craftsmanship. He highlights the evolution of Hermès from bespoke harnesses to a global luxury icon, emphasizing their commitment to artistry amidst market pressures. Dumas also reveals the creative processes behind their iconic designs, like the Birkin and Kelly bags, balancing tradition with contemporary needs. Additionally, he discusses the cultural significance of Hermès in France’s luxury market and the challenges of preserving craftsmanship in a fast-paced industry.
